How Taking AL West Lead Impacts Houston Astros' Playoff Numbers

The Houston Astros are now back in front in the American League West and that chances its postseason scenarios down the stretch.

The Houston Astros have climbed the mountain and have taken the lead in the American League West for the first time this season.

The Astros defeated the Texas Rangers, 14-1, on Tuesday. That, combined with the Seattle Mariners’ loss to the Cincinnati Reds, put the Astros in position to take the lead.

But it’s by no means a done deal that the Astros will stay there. The AL West might be the most competitive race down the stretch and even though the lead flipped, it will not take much for the Astros to fall back into the Wild Card race, which continues to be close as well.

Below is an update on the race, with the current standings, magic numbers to clinch the AL West and a Wild Card berth, along with the remaining schedules for the teams that are still in the race as the Astros wrap up their series with the Rangers on Wednesday.
